P.V. Siva Sankar, v. The State Of Andhra Pradesh,
THE H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E A.RAJASHEKER REDDY W.P.NO.42563 OF 2017
O R D E R
Aggrieved by the action of the respondents in laying the road through the land of the petitioners without following the procedure and paying compensation under the provisions of Right to Fair Compensation and Transparency in Land Acquisition and Resettlement Act, 2013 the present writ petition has been filed.
Heard the learned counsel for the petitioners. The learned Assistant Government Pleader for Land Acquisition, on instructions, would submit that respondents will not interfere with the possession of the petitioners and that they will follow due procedure established under law before laying the road through the subject land of the petitioners.
Recording the above statement made by the learned Assistant Government Pleader for Land Acquisition, the writ petition is disposed of directing the respondents not to interfere with the possession of the petitioners over the subjec t land without following the due process of law. Miscellaneous petitions pending, if any, shall stand closed. No order as to costs.
